Как программно создать колонки в таблице значений на платформе 1С?

Для программного создания колонок в таблице значений в 1С используется метод 'Добавить'. Он применяется к объекту 'Колонки' таблицы значений и позволяет добавить новую колонку с указанным именем. Важно помнить, что каждая колонка должна иметь уникальное имя.

При работе с системами на базе 1С часто возникает необходимость формировать табличные данные программным путём. Это особенно актуально при разработке сложных отчетов или обработок данных.

Таблица Значений — это структура данных, которая представляет собой набор строк, каждая из которых содержит одинаковый набор полей (колонок). Для работы с этой структурой есть специальный объект — ТаблицаЗначений.

Чтобы добавить новую колонку в таблицу значений, нужно использовать метод ‘Добавить’, который применяется к объекту ‘Колонки’ данной таблицы. Пример кода выглядит следующим образом:

НоваяТаблица = Новый ТаблицаЗначений;НоваяТаблица.Колонки.Добавить('Имя');

В этом примере создается новая таблица значений и в нее добавляется колонка ‘Имя’. Каждая колонка в таблице должна иметь уникальное имя, иначе будет сгенерировано исключение. Если требуется добавить несколько колонок, то метод ‘Добавить’ вызывается для каждой из них отдельно.

Также можно указать тип данных для новой колонки:

НоваяТаблица.Колонки.Добавить('Дата', Новый ОписаниеТипов('Дата'));

В данном примере добавляется колонка ‘Дата’ типа Дата.

Создание таблицы значений — это лишь первый шаг. После этого её нужно заполнить данными, а затем использовать в соответствии с поставленной задачей: вывод информации на экран, формирование отчетов или выполнение расчетов.

С наступающим Новым Годом!

У вас 0

Упс… Кажется, не хватает снежинок.
Лови больше снежинок на сайте.

Снеговик

1С в облаке
— это не страшно!

Как программно создать колонки в таблице значений на платформе 1С? - 42CLOUDS

Нажимая на кнопку, Вы даете согласие на обработку персональных данных

Оставьте отзыв о нас

Расскажите, как сервис 42Clouds помог вашему бизнесу.

Отзыв будет опубликован после проверки модератором.

Оставьте заявку. Мы свяжемся с вами в самое ближайшее время.

*нажимая на кнопку, Вы даете согласие на обработку персональных данных

Оставьте заявку. Мы свяжемся с вами в самое ближайшее время.

*нажимая на кнопку, Вы даете согласие на обработку персональных данных